Please choose the appropriate forum for this topic. Thank you. Here is my tribute to my favorite band, Alkaline trio. I bought an extra face and painted it with a black base coat. The graphics were made via printable water transfer decal paper. I simply printed them out and transfered them just like regular decals to the ipod face (it was a royal pain). The final step was to add layer upon layer of clear gloss coat. Overall I am very satisfied. The decals are a little grainy up close and the screen on the face was pretty scratched when I got so I still have to take care of that. The scroll wheel and the buttons work perfectly despite the layers of paint and decals. You can sorta see how the red/orange lights illuminate the eyes of the skulls. Oh yeah, I did the brushed metal finish on the back also.
